The Towers of Utopia

In this 1975 novel Mack Reynolds equipped every resident of Skyler Deme with a "TV Phone" that was also a "Universal Credit Card", and was routinely used to query "the computers" as well as being a RFID-like access card.

I last read this about 20 years ago. Re-reading it now - this is probably the best depiction of a "smart phone" in pre-web science fiction that I can think of.
